I own #199729 that is a 32" Wild Fowl with all 3 ordnance marks plus V.A. 2116 on the right lock plate but with 2 3/4" chambers and no barrel reinforcing loop. that suggests these early Rochester guns were intended for 3" chambers before the War and were hurriedly diverted into the Rochester program. Regarding the question about US and USA-F 20 gauge, conventional wisdom is that those were war time barrel marks unrelated to the Rochester or military program. My #FW200190 is one of those guns. The only known Rochester 20 gauge is #201424.
